A-10 Thunderbolt II vs MiG-21 Fishbed
The A-10 Thunderbolt II and the MiG-21 Fishbed are both Combat Aircraft, manufactured by Fairchild Republic and Mikoyan-Gurevitch respectively. The MiG-21 Fishbed reaches 2,125 km/h — 3.1x the A-10 Thunderbolt II's 675 km/h. The A-10 Thunderbolt II has an operational range of 463 km vs 660 km for the MiG-21 Fishbed. The MiG-21 Fishbed operates at altitudes up to 19,000 m compared to 13,716 m for the A-10 Thunderbolt II. At 22,680 kg MTOW, the A-10 Thunderbolt II is 2.6x the MiG-21 Fishbed's 8,625 kg. The A-10 Thunderbolt II has been produced in 716 units vs 11,496 for the MiG-21 Fishbed. Unit cost is $20M for the A-10 Thunderbolt II vs $2M for the MiG-21 Fishbed. The MiG-21 Fishbed first flew 17 years before the A-10 Thunderbolt II (1955 vs 1972).
